About

Gustavo Alberto Rached Taiar’s practices focuses on corporate law, M&A, private equity, venture capital, investment funds, structured finance, and project finance. He has extensive experience advising private and institutional investors, foreign clients, multinational corporations, and Brazilian companies of all sizes on complex domestic and cross-border transactions.

His practice combines strong legal expertise with an entrepreneurial mindset, with particular focus on transactions in the energy, technology, financial markets, and agribusiness sectors. He regularly leads buy-side and sell-side M&A processes, corporate structurings, joint ventures, private capital raisings, and structured financings, consistently targeting the delivery of commercial solutions aligned with his clients’ strategic objectives.

Before joining the firm, Gustavo spent 10 years as an attorney at a leading full-service law firm in São Paulo and eight years as an attorney and partner at another major full-service law firm in São Paulo. He gained international experience as a foreign associate at a U.S. law firm in New York, where he developed deep familiarity with Anglo-American practice standards and the execution of cross-border transactions.
